- Tip 1: Calculate Quantity Based on Attendance. Aim for one unit per 50 guests for events under 4 hours, scaling up for longer durations. For a 200-person festival, that’s at least four units, plus extras for families.
- Tip 2: Prioritize Placement for Accessibility. Position units near high-traffic areas but away from food zones to avoid odors. In San Bernardino’s windy spots, secure them against gusts.
- Tip 3: Choose the Right Type for Your Event. Standard units work for basics, but add handwashing stations for upscale gatherings.
- Tip 4: Schedule Regular Servicing. In the heat, waste decomposes faster, so plan cleanings every 24-48 hours.
- Tip 5: Educate Staff on Maintenance Protocols. Train volunteers to monitor usage and report issues promptly.

Actionable How-To: Implementing the Top 5 Porta Potty Tips
Putting these tips into practice requires foresight, especially with San Bernardino’s variable weather – think 100°F days that accelerate bacteria growth or rainy seasons that complicate ground stability. Start by assessing your venue: urban lots in downtown San Bernardino might need concrete pads for stability, while park events benefit from grassy placements with gravel bases.
Here’s how to apply each tip step-by-step:
-
Quantity Calculation: Use online tools or consult pros to estimate needs. For a music event at Glen Helen Regional Park, factor in alcohol consumption, which increases usage by 20%. Order early to avoid shortages during peak seasons like summer fairs.
-
Strategic Placement: Map your site layout. Place units 50-100 feet from entrances for convenience, ensuring ADA-compliant options for accessibility. Local regulations require clear paths, so avoid bottlenecks near stages.
-
Selecting Units: Opt for ventilated models to combat desert heat. For family events, include changing stations. San Bernardino’s events often pair well with our standard porta potty rental for cost-effectiveness.
-
Servicing Schedule: Coordinate with your rental provider for daily checks. In hot weather, add deodorizers to control smells. Track usage logs to adjust for peak times.
- Staff Training: Brief your team on hand sanitizer refills and spill protocols. Use signage for user instructions to minimize misuse.

Common Mistakes to Avoid with Porta Potties at San Bernardino Events
Even seasoned organizers slip up on porta potty management, leading to costly repercussions in San Bernardino’s regulated environment. One frequent error is underestimating unit numbers, resulting in long waits that frustrate attendees and risk health violations – fines can hit $500 per infraction under county rules.
Another pitfall: poor placement, like positioning near barbecue areas, which amplifies odors in the heat and deters use, potentially causing unsanitary alternatives like bushes. We’ve seen events shut down early due to complaints, costing thousands in lost revenue.
Skipping regular cleanings is disastrous; in San Bernardino’s warmth, neglected units breed bacteria, posing safety risks like infections. Financially, emergency services can double rental fees.
Finally, ignoring local factors – such as not securing units against Santa Ana winds – leads to topples and injuries. Always verify permits; unpermitted setups invite legal headaches.
